7. Flush the TurboFiller with clean water from the rinsing tank or from an external tank by shifting to suction. The
TurboFiller suction valve must be open for at least 20 seconds after the rinse water is no longer visible in the hopper,
in order to completely empty the transfer hoses into the main tank.

ATTENTION! If not flushed with clean water, the hopper rinsing device uses spray liquid for rinsing the hopper!
Cleaning the TurboFiller must always be done, when the spray job is ended, and together with cleaning the entire
sprayer. A cleaning after the last filling, and before spraying, does not ensure a clean TurboFiller!
8. Close TurboFiller suction valve, when the hopper has been rinsed. Close the lid.
9. If closed, turn the AgitationValve towards “Agitation”.
10. When the spray liquid is well agitated, turn handle of the pressure
valve towards “Spraying” position. Keep PTO engaged, so that the
spray liquid is continuously agitated, until it has been sprayed on
the crop.

ATTENTION! If foaming is a problem, turn down the agitation.
